Understanding the Core Mechanics and Appeal
The fundamental appeal of these ‘crash’ games lies in their simplicity and the instant gratification they offer. Unlike traditional casino games that can involve complex rules and strategies, these games are incredibly easy to understand and play. A player simply places a bet, chooses a payout multiplier, and hopes the virtual airplane doesn’t crash before reaching that multiplier. This accessibility makes them attractive to a broad audience, including those new to online betting. The visual element – watching the plane ascend and the multiplier grow – adds an extra layer of excitement and suspense. The feeling of narrowly escaping a crash with a substantial win can be incredibly addictive, contributing to the game’s popularity. This ties into core psychological principles related to reward systems and the excitement of near-misses.
The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
It's crucial to understand that the outcome of these games is determined by a Random Number Generator (RNG). A certified and rigorously tested RNG ensures fairness and prevents manipulation. Reputable platforms will openly disclose information about their RNG certification, demonstrating their commitment to transparency and player protection. The RNG creates a truly random event that dictates when the plane will crash, making each round unpredictable. This is different from skill-based games where a player’s abilities directly affect the outcome. Players should familiarize themselves with the concept of RNGs to have realistic expectations and understand that winning is based on chance, not strategy.

Strategies and Risk Management
While the core mechanic of these games relies on chance, players often adopt various strategies to manage their risk and potentially increase their winnings. One common strategy is to set a target multiplier and automatically cash out when that target is reached, regardless of whether the plane is still climbing. This helps to protect profits and avoid the risk of a sudden crash. Another strategy involves using a “double up” approach, where players attempt to recover losses by doubling their bet after each loss. However, this strategy can be incredibly risky and should be approached with caution. The most important aspect of playing these games is responsible bankroll management – setting a budget and sticking to it, and never betting more than you can afford to lose. Understanding your risk tolerance is a critical element of successful participation.
Common Betting Strategies Explained
Many players experiment with different betting approaches. Some employ the Martingale system, increasing their stake after each loss, hoping to recoup previous losses with a single win. This can be dangerous as it requires a substantial bankroll and the potential for significant losses escalates rapidly. Others utilize the D'Alembert system, increasing their bet by one unit after a loss and decreasing it by one unit after a win. This strategy is less aggressive than Martingale but still carries inherent risks. The key takeaway is that no strategy guarantees success, and all strategies should be implemented alongside strict bankroll management. Recognize that these games are ultimately based on luck, and there's no foolproof way to predict the outcome.
